As schools go on break for the holidays, GOtv is officially welcoming kids to the festive season with a wide range of fun-filled and exciting programming that even grown-ups can enjoy! And with the introduction of two new kids’ channels – Cartoon Network and Da Vinci – on GOtv Max, kids will be spoilt for choice making GOtv the ultimate destination this holiday season.

 From Educational programmes, arts & crafts to exciting adventures, GOtv has got the kiddies covered this week!

 Here are seven shows to keep the kids entertained during the holidays:

 M-Net Movies Zone Kids Club: The M-Net Movies Zone Kids Club is a 5-hour block featuring some of the coolest and intriguing shows for teens on M-Net Moves Zone (channel 3). Showing Sunday, 15th December Mirror Mirror. When Snow White’s evil stepmother takes over her kingdom and banishes her to the woods, she is forced to team up with a ragtag bunch of seven dwarfs to take back what’s rightfully hers. Watch it this Sunday at 7:44pm

 

 Pinkalicious & Peterrific is showing on PBS (channel 65): On this episode, Pinkalicious brings her pet unicorn, Goldie, to school and she soon discovers that even imaginary unicorns must follow rules. Catch this on Thursday, 12th December at 10:12am.

Do not miss out on this episode of Messy Goes to Okido on Jim Jam (channel 61): Messy’s tummy is rumbling and so is Lofty the giant. Luckily the gang are hungry to solve this scientific mystery. Tune in Friday, 13th December at 6am.

 For kids who love arts and crafts, Science Max is showing on Da Vinci (channel 66): This show will surely keep their hands busy! On this episode, Phil builds a bridge out of pasta, it’s not too hard and works better than you think. But what if we were to try to make a pasta bridge big enough for Phil to walk across? In addition, you will learn how to build a sandcastle you can stand on! Catch this on Friday, 13th December at 9am.

Catch the Best Holidays Ever Marathon of SpongeBob on Nickelodeon (channel 62):  There will be winter episodes and Christmas specials to celebrate SpongeBob’s Best Year Ever! Showing Saturday, 14th at 12pm and Sunday, 15th December at 4:15pm.

 Apple & Onion premieres on Monday, 16th December on Cartoon Network (channel 67): This show centres around two best friends, who live in a big city full of other food people. Together, they use their can-do attitudes out of the box thinking to find new adventures around every corner, take on the challenges of life in the big city, and make some new friends along the way! The kids can tune in weekdays at 4:20pm.

 The Kiddies can follow Fancy Nancy Clancy on her adventures on Disney Junior (channel 60): Fancy Nancy goes on exciting adventures with family and friends, as she finds the extraordinary in the ordinary, and with a little imagination transforms the plain into the exquisite. This show premieres on the 16th December, showing weekdays at 8:30am.
